本文目录导读:
图片来源于网络,如有侵权联系删除
随着信息技术的飞速发展,数据已成为企业、组织和个人不可或缺的重要资源,关系数据库作为一种广泛使用的数据管理技术,在众多领域发挥着关键作用,关系数据库究竟是由什么组成的呢?本文将深入剖析关系数据库的组成要素,以帮助读者更好地理解和应用这一技术。
关系数据库的基本概念
关系数据库是一种基于关系模型的数据管理技术,它将数据组织成一系列的表(关系),每个表由行(元组)和列(属性)组成,关系数据库通过定义表结构、数据类型、约束条件等,实现对数据的存储、查询、更新和删除等操作。
关系数据库的组成要素
1、数据库管理系统(DBMS)
数据库管理系统是关系数据库的核心组成部分,它负责管理数据库的创建、维护、使用和保护,DBMS提供了数据定义语言(DDL)、数据操纵语言(DML)、数据控制语言(DCL)等工具,以实现对数据库的全面管理。
2、数据模型
数据模型是关系数据库的基础,它描述了数据的组织结构和语义,关系模型是最常用的数据模型,它将数据组织成一系列的表,每个表由行和列组成,关系模型具有以下特点:
(1)实体:表中的每一行代表一个实体,即一个具体的对象。
(2)属性:表中的每一列代表实体的一个属性,即实体的一个特征。
(3)关系:表与表之间的联系称为关系,它通过外键实现。
图片来源于网络,如有侵权联系删除
3、数据结构
数据结构是关系数据库中存储数据的方式,它包括以下几种类型:
(1)表:表是关系数据库的基本数据结构,它由行和列组成。
(2)视图:视图是虚拟的表,它基于一个或多个表的数据生成。
(3)索引:索引是一种数据结构,它用于提高查询效率。
4、数据完整性
数据完整性是关系数据库的重要特性,它确保了数据的准确性和一致性,数据完整性包括以下几种类型:
(1)实体完整性:保证表中每行数据都是唯一的。
(2)参照完整性:保证表与表之间的关系是有效的。
图片来源于网络,如有侵权联系删除
(3)用户定义完整性:由用户根据实际需求定义的完整性约束。
5、安全性
安全性是关系数据库的关键特性,它确保了数据的保密性和可靠性,安全性包括以下几种类型:
(1)用户权限:控制用户对数据库的访问权限。
(2)数据加密:对敏感数据进行加密,防止泄露。
(3)审计:记录数据库的操作历史,便于追踪和审计。
关系数据库作为一种高效的数据管理技术,在众多领域发挥着关键作用,本文深入剖析了关系数据库的组成要素,包括数据库管理系统、数据模型、数据结构、数据完整性和安全性等,掌握这些要素,有助于我们更好地理解和应用关系数据库,为构建高效的数据管理系统奠定坚实基础。
标签: #关系数据库是由什么组成的呢
评论列表